Eligibility Criteria for Claiming Compensation

To be eligible for claiming compensation due to flight delays, passengers must meet certain criteria set by the airline or the governing aviation authority. These criteria typically include factors such as the length of the delay, the distance of the flight, and the reason for the delay.

Duration of Delay

  • For short delays: Passengers may not be eligible for compensation if the delay is less than a certain number of hours, typically around 2-3 hours.
  • For medium delays: Compensation may be provided for delays between 3-5 hours, but the exact threshold varies by airline and jurisdiction.
  • For long delays: Delays of more than 5 hours usually result in passengers being eligible for compensation, which may increase with the duration of the delay.

Determining Eligibility

  • Passengers can determine their eligibility for compensation by checking the airline’s terms and conditions, which often outline the compensation rules for various scenarios.
  • It is important to keep records of the flight details, such as the departure and arrival times, as well as any communication with the airline regarding the delay.
  • Passengers can also seek assistance from consumer rights organizations or legal professionals to understand their rights and options for claiming compensation.

Additional Tips and Information

When it comes to claiming compensation for flight delays or cancellations, there are several tips that passengers can follow to increase their chances of success. Ensuring you have the necessary documentation and understanding your legal rights are crucial steps in the process.

Tips to Increase Chances of Claiming Compensation

  • Keep all your travel documents, including your ticket, boarding pass, and any communication from the airline.
  • Take note of the reason for the delay or cancellation and any announcements made by the airline staff.
  • File your claim as soon as possible, as there are time limits for making a claim.
  • Consider using a reputable flight compensation service to help you navigate the process.

Documentation Required for Claiming Compensation

  • Proof of booking and travel documents.
  • Evidence of the delay or cancellation, such as a letter from the airline or a screenshot of the flight status.
  • Receipts for any additional expenses incurred due to the delay or cancellation.
  • Any correspondence with the airline regarding the incident.

Legal Rights and Resources for Passengers

  • Passengers have rights under the European Union Regulation 261/2004 for flight delays and cancellations.
  • There are online resources and forums where passengers can seek advice and support when claiming compensation.
  • If your claim is denied, you have the right to escalate the issue to the relevant aviation authority or ombudsman for further review.
